If you have captured a web page using the conifer application and it won't display in Starter and gives a message of ‘format doesn’t have an associated renderer’

 

  • Find the original file you downloaded from Conifer and change the file extension to .zip in Windows Explorer or MacOS.
  • Extract the zip file to a local folder.
  • Change the extension of the unzipped file back to .warc
  • Upload into Starter again.

 

The native output of Conifer is not quite compatible with Starter and the method above should fix that.

@Michael Friesen, it looks like the latest version (at least) of the webrecorder extension outputs in a wacz as opposed to warc format. Preservica now renders wacz so the first thing I would try is uploading the file directly without going through any of those steps
